What Are Onboard Scales?
Onboard scales are electronic weighing systems integrated into mobile machinery or vehicles. They measure the weight of the material being carried or processed without the need to unload or transport the material to a separate weighing station. These scales use sensors like load cells or strain gauges to provide instant weight readings, which are typically displayed on a digital screen in the operator’s cab.
By bringing weighing capability directly to the point of operation, onboard scales streamline workflows, enhance decision-making, and improve overall operational efficiency.

Key Features of Reliable Onboard Scales
- High Accuracy
Accurate weight measurement is the cornerstone of a reliable onboard scale. Precision sensors and advanced calibration methods ensure measurements are within a tight tolerance range, often less than ±1%. This accuracy allows operators to optimize payloads and improve operational planning. - Durability and Robustness
Onboard scales are exposed to challenging conditions—dust, moisture, vibration, and temperature extremes. Reliable models are built with rugged materials and sealed electronics to ensure longevity and consistent performance, even in the harshest environments. - User-Friendly Interface
A clear, intuitive display and easy-to-use controls reduce operator errors and training time. Many reliable onboard scales feature touchscreen displays, customizable settings, and quick tare functions that facilitate smooth operation. - Data Logging and Connectivity
Modern onboard scales often include data storage and wireless connectivity options. This enables seamless transfer of weight records to central databases or fleet management systems for real-time monitoring, reporting, and compliance documentation. - Easy Integration and Installation
A reliable onboard scale system should be adaptable to various vehicle types and configurations, with straightforward installation and minimal interference with existing vehicle functions.

Applications of Reliable Onboard Scales
- Agriculture: Weighing harvested crops, fertilizers, and feed directly on tractors or harvesters increases efficiency during peak seasons.
- Construction: Measuring materials like sand, gravel, and concrete on trucks and loaders ensures precise delivery and billing.
- Waste Management: Tracking waste volumes on garbage trucks enables accurate billing and reporting.
- Logistics and Freight: Ensuring trucks comply with weight limits avoids fines and prolongs vehicle life.
- Mining and Quarrying: Onboard scales help manage material extraction and transport with high accuracy.
Maintenance and Calibration
To maintain reliability, onboard scales require regular maintenance and calibration. This ensures sensors remain accurate and electronics function properly. Many manufacturers offer support services for calibration, firmware updates, and repairs to minimize downtime.
Operators should follow recommended maintenance schedules, keep sensors clean, and protect electronic components from excessive moisture or impact.
